'We made a mistake': Dark Mofo pulls the plug on 'deeply harmful' Indigenous blood work

The Tasmanian festival renowned for pushing artistic boundaries has admitted that this time it may have gone too far

Tasmania’s Dark Mofo festival has cancelled one of the key works planned for the June event and apologised, after a social media backlash led by Indigenous artists around Australia.

On Tuesday afternoon organisers of the winter festival, which is run by the Museum of Old and New Art (Mona), announced that the work by Spanish artist Santiago Sierra – in which he planned to immerse a Union Flag into the donated blood of Indigenous people, as a statement “against colonialism” – would no longer go ahead.
